Kandungan fitokimia dan aktivitas antibakteri ekstrak etanol biji buah nyirih (Xylocarpus granatum ): Phytochemical and antibacterial activity of ethanol extract from cannonball mangrove (Xylocarpus granatum) fruit seeds

Abstract

Xylocarpus granatum (cannonball mangrove) is a mangrove species known as nyirih fruit in South Kalimantan. This study aims to determine the phytochemical content and antibacterial activity of the seeds from X. granatum fruit. The research stages included preparing cannonball mangrove fruit into powder, extracting the seed powder with ethanol, conducting phytochemical tests on the seed powder, preparing test bacteria, and testing the antibacterial properties of the ethanol extract from the cannonball mangrove seeds. The parameters tested were yield, proximate, phytochemical, and antibacterial tests against E. coli and S. aureus. The yield of cannonball mangrove fruit seeds was 21.17%, and the powder weight was 7.04%. Cannonball mangrove fruit seed powder contains 4.97% water content, 2.56% ash, 4.54% protein, 0.63% fat, and 2.5% crude fiber. Cannonball mangrove fruit seed powder contains saponins, alkaloids, flavonoids, tannins, triterpenoids, phenolics, steroids, and anthocyanins. The results of the antibacterial test showed that increasing the concentration of ethanol extract of cannonball mangrove fruit seed powder was inversely proportional to the total bacteria but directly proportional to the percent inhibition. Extracts of 20-90 µL showed total E. coli bacteria of log 9.32 CFU/g and log 1.18 CFU/g with percent inhibition of 5.93 and 88.05%. Extract concentrations of 1-15 µL against S. aureus bacteria showed total bacterial values of log 5.69 CFU/g and log 8.65 CFU/g with percent inhibition of 29.37 and 64.46. Penelitian ini bertujuan menentukan kandungan fitokimia dan aktivitas antibakteri biji buah X. granatum. Tahapan penelitian adalah preparasi buah nyirih menjadi bubuk buah nyirih, ekstraksi bubuk biji buah nyirih dengan pelarut etanol, uji fitokimia bubuk biji buah nyirih, preparasi bakteri uji, dan uji antibakteri ekstrak etanol biji buah nyirih. Parameter yang diuji, yaitu rendemen, proksimat, fitokimia, dan uji antibakteri terhadap E. coli dan S.aureus. Rendemen biji buah nyirih adalah 21,17% dan berat bubuk 7,04%. Bubuk biji buah nyirih mengandung kadar air 4,97%, abu 2,56%, protein 4,54 %, lemak 0,63%, dan serat kasar 2,5%. Bubuk biji buah nyirih mengandung senyawa saponin, alkaloid, flavonoid, tannin, triterpenoid, fenolik, steroid, dan antosianin. Hasil uji antibakteri menunjukkan bahwa peningkatan konsentrasi ekstrak etanol bubuk biji buah nyirih berbanding terbalik dengan total bakteri akan tetapi berbanding lurus dengan persen penghambatan. Ekstrak 20–90 µL memperlihatkan total bakteri E. coli sebesar log 9,32 CFU/g dan log 1,18 CFU/g dengan persen penghambatan sebesar 5,93 dan 88,05%. Konsentrasi ekstrak 1–15 µL terhadap bakteri S. aureus memperlihatkan nilai total bakteri sebesar log 5,69 CFU/g dan log 8,65 CFU/g dengan persen penghambatan sebesar 29,37 dan 64,46. Pengujian antibakteri dengan metode kontak langsung menunjukkan kemampuan ekstrak etanol bubuk biji buah nyirih menghambat pertumbuhan bakteri E. coli dan S. aureus pada konsentrasi ekstrak yang rendah
